What is the difference between Executive Limousine vs Chauffeur?

AspectExecutive LimousineChauffeur
CredentialsDriver's license, possibly chauffeur certificationDriver's license, chauffeur certification often preferred
Work EnvironmentLuxury vehicles, corporate events, airport transfersLuxury vehicles, private clients, events
Employer & IndustryLuxury transportation companies, corporate clientsPrivate individuals, luxury service providers
Search & Comparison IntentExecutive Limousine vs Chauffeur

While both roles involve driving luxury vehicles, Executive Limousine drivers typically work for transportation companies serving corporate and high-end clients, focusing on executive and airport transfers. Chauffeurs often serve private clients or luxury service providers, emphasizing personalized service. The main difference lies in the scope of service and employer type, but both require similar credentials and operate in the luxury transportation indust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ive limousine driver?

To thrive as an Executive Limousine Driver, you need a valid commercial driver's license (CDL), an excellent driving record, and thorough knowledge of local traffic laws and routes.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, reservation management software, and vehicle maintenance procedures is essential. Outstanding customer service, discretion, punctuality, and strong interpersonal communication set top drivers apart. These skills and qualities ensure client safety, satisfaction, and a seamless, professional transportation experience.

What are some common challenges faced by executive limousine dr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Executive Limousine drivers often encounter challenges such as navigating heavy traffic, adapting to last-minute schedule changes, and ensuring a high level of customer service for VIP clients. Managing these challenges effectively involves strong communication with dispatchers, using GPS and traffic apps to optimize routes, and maintaining professionalism even under pressure. Building a rapport with clients and being flexible with changing itineraries are also key to success in this role.

What is an executive limousine service?

An executive limousine service provides luxury transportation for business professionals, executives, and VIPs. These services offer high-end vehicles such as sedans, SUVs, and stretch limousines, often equipped with amenities like Wi-Fi, refreshments, and privacy features. Executive limousine services are commonly used for airport transfers, corporate events, client meetings, and special occasions where comfort, reliability, and discretion are essential. Chauffeurs are professionally trained to deliver exceptional service and ensure a smooth, punctual ride. These services prioritize safety, convenience, and a premium travel experience.
